excel 2007 edit comment problem
 
I opened a cell comment to edit in Excel 2007 worksheet, and half my
worksheet went blank. Any comments, feedback, or assistance appreciated. I
retrieved the work with undo.

JLatham

excel 2007 edit comment problem
 
Is the problem repeatable? Might make a copy of that file (just in case it
is repeatable) and then try the edit of the comment again on the original to
see if it misbehaves that way again. Also, if it does apparently delete data
on the sheet, instead of using UNDO immediately, choose a few of the cells
and see if their contents actually got deleted or if the video display simply
isn't showing them.

excel 2007 edit comment problem
 
Thx JLatham. Just figured it out. The edit comment box opened so far
offscreen I couldn't see my work. Thanks.
